Transaction 5316290785cbf9ca9204aeb735d5e6b984ef60e78669dad7e03edbdec9ab5e85

1 Input
2 Outputs
  • 5316290785cbf9ca9204aeb735d5e6b984ef60e78669dad7e03edbdec9ab5e85:0
  • value  565806678
    address  1DUgHqXbdwy9Ud35UEN56gsWg3sLjcHHnP
  • 5316290785cbf9ca9204aeb735d5e6b984ef60e78669dad7e03edbdec9ab5e85:1
  • value  6081663
    address  1FKGa8s6bUEX961SUXfvwaZHn1vkGUZ3VM